Question: In recent years, 22 percent of the American made automobiles sold in the United States were manufactured by General Motors, 24 percent by Ford, 6 percent by Daimler-Chrysler, and 48 percent by all others. A sample of the sales of American-made automobiles conducted last week revealed that 36 were manufactured by Daimler Chrysler, 220 by Ford, 125 by GM, and 345 by all others. Do these observations fit with the expected values at a .01 level of significance?
